Output 89d27cf2894054b424819d8049b7575d13a9258e9e2a700d14fa267276d93ab8:0

value
12600
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0666516c8ee3924ecbdf72821dd305a8c658ca5e1e69f79ec9e80304392f401f
address
tb1pqen9zmywuwfyaj7lw2ppm5c94rr93jj7re5l08kfaqpsgwf0gq0sdas24q
transaction
89d27cf2894054b424819d8049b7575d13a9258e9e2a700d14fa267276d93ab8
confirmations
30437
spent
true